Smart Home Tech for the Connected, Savvy Homeowner

Smart home technology can make your life a lot easier – and a lot more futuristic. Add these gadgets to your daily life and you’ll feel like you’re on The Jetsons.

1. Smart Thermostats

New-fangled thermostats are getting incredibly intelligent. The freshest models can learn your heating and cooling habits and adjust their settings accordingly. They also let you control your settings from your smartphone, so you won’t have to worry about turning the heat down before you leave on your long trip – you can do it from your airplane’s Wi-Fi.

2. Smart Lighting

Like smart thermostats, smart lighting can be controlled from your phone, including dimming settings. They can also totally transform the mood in a room by changing colors.

3. Home Assistants

Home assistants like Siri, Alexa, and Google can perform lots of tasks for you, hands-free – all you have to do is ask. Getting a model means your home assistant is constantly listening, waiting for you to tell it what to do. For instance, ask for the weather, tell it to play a song, or buy more dish detergent.

4. Smart Smoke Detectors

A smart smoke detector not only alerts you when it senses noxious gas, it also sends alerts to your phone if you’re away from home. If the alarm goes off because your cooking got a little hot, this setting is phone-controllable, too. This means you’ll no longer have to drag over a wobbly chair to deactivate your inconveniently placed, wailing smoke detector.

5. Smart Outlets

It’s 2017, so of course smart home tech can now include your power outlets. You can get adapter-like models that fit into your existing outlet. Once these are plugged in, the outlet has the ability to be controlled from – you guessed it – your smartphone.

That’s not all, though. These devices will monitor how much electricity your plugged-in items are using. If you suspect one is a power vampire, you can direct the app to shut off the outlet when the usage hits a set limit.
